Road Grading in Atlanta, GA
Road grading services involve the process of leveling and shaping the surface of dirt or gravel roads, driveways, and pathways to ensure proper drainage and stability. This service is commonly requested for projects such as residential driveway maintenance, access roads for farms or rural properties, or preparing land for new construction. Homeowners should consider the current condition of their property’s access routes, noting issues like uneven surfaces, pooling water, or erosion, which can benefit from grading to improve safety and usability.
Before requesting road grading,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work required, including the extent of surface unevenness and the desired outcome. It’s important to evaluate whether existing surfaces need complete reshaping or just minor adjustments, and to consider how the grading may impact drainage patterns on the property. Clear communication about the specific needs and the current condition of the area can help ensure the project results meet expectations.

Road Grading Questions
What is road grading? Road grading involves leveling and shaping the soil surface to create a stable, even foundation for driveways, access roads, or parking areas.
When is road grading needed? It is typically needed to correct uneven surfaces, improve drainage, and prepare land for construction or landscaping projects.
What types of projects benefit from road grading? Projects such as residential driveways, farm access roads, and commercial parking lots often require grading to ensure proper drainage and surface stability.
How does road grading improve property drainage? Proper grading directs water away from structures and prevents pooling, reducing erosion and water damage on the property.
